The Importance of Critical Thinking and Informed Decision-Making

In a world saturated with information, it's more important than ever to develop critical thinking skills and to be able to distinguish between fact and fiction. We need to be able to evaluate sources of information, identify biases, and form our own informed opinions. This is especially crucial when it comes to today's news headlines, which can often be sensationalized or misleading.

One way to improve your critical thinking skills is to seek out diverse perspectives. Don't just rely on one news source or social media platform. Read articles from different outlets, listen to different viewpoints, and engage in respectful dialogue with people who have different opinions. This will help you to develop a more nuanced understanding of the issues and to avoid falling prey to groupthink.

Another important skill is to be able to identify biases. Everyone has biases, whether they are conscious or unconscious. It's important to be aware of your own biases and to consider how they might be influencing your interpretation of information. You can also try to identify the biases of others by looking for patterns in their language, their choice of sources, and their overall tone.

Finally, it's important to be skeptical of information that seems too good to be true or that confirms your existing beliefs. Check the facts, look for evidence to support the claims, and consider whether there might be alternative explanations. By developing these critical thinking skills, you can become a more informed and engaged citizen.

Staying Informed: Resources and Recommendations

Staying informed about today's news headlines is essential for being an engaged and responsible citizen. However, with the constant barrage of information, it can be difficult to know where to turn for reliable and unbiased news. Here are some resources and recommendations to help you stay informed:

  • Reputable News Organizations: Stick to established news organizations with a proven track record of accurate reporting. Examples include the Associated Press, Reuters, The New York Times, The Wall Street Journal, and the BBC.
  • Fact-Checking Websites: Use fact-checking websites like Snopes, PolitiFact, and FactCheck.org to verify the accuracy of information you encounter online.
  • Diverse Sources: Don't rely on just one news source. Read articles from different outlets with different perspectives to get a more well-rounded understanding of the issues.
  • Expert Analysis: Seek out analysis from experts in various fields to gain deeper insights into complex issues. Look for academics, researchers, and policy analysts who have a strong understanding of the topics you're interested in.
  • Primary Sources: Whenever possible, consult primary sources of information, such as government reports, scientific studies, and original documents.
  • Media Literacy Education: Educate yourself about media literacy and learn how to identify bias, misinformation, and propaganda.
  • Critical Thinking: Develop your critical thinking skills and learn how to evaluate information, identify logical fallacies, and form your own informed opinions.
  • Social Media Awareness: Be aware of the potential for misinformation and echo chambers on social media. Follow a diverse range of accounts and be critical of the information you encounter.
  • Local News: Don't forget to stay informed about local news and events in your community. Local news outlets often provide coverage of issues that are not covered by national media.
  • International News: Expand your horizons and stay informed about international news and events. Understanding global issues is essential for being a well-rounded and informed citizen.

By using these resources and recommendations, you can stay informed about the world around you and make informed decisions about the issues that matter most.

Each player places a bet, and then three cards are dealt face down to each of the players. They all have the choice whether to play without seeing their cards also known as blind or after looking at them known as seen . Players take turns placing bets or folding. The player with the best hand, according to the card rankings, wins.
